display process memory heap
Use display process memory heap to display heap memory usage for a user process.
Syntax
Centralized devices in standalone mode:
display process memory heap job job-id [ verbose ]
Distributed devices in standalone mode/centralized devices in IRF mode:
display process memory heap job job-id [ verbose ] [ slot slot-number [ cpu cpu-number ] ]
Distributed devices in IRF mode:
display process memory heap job job-id [ verbose ] [ chassis chassis-number slot slot-number
[ cpu cpu-number ] ]
Views
Any view
Predefined user roles
network-admin
network-operator
Parameters
job job-id: Specifies a user process by its job ID, in the range of 1 to 2147483647.
verbose: Displays detailed information. If you do not specify this keyword, the command displays
brief information.
slot slot-number: Specifies a card by its slot number. If you do not specify this option, the command
displays heap memory usage for the user process on the active MPU. (Distributed devices in
standalone mode.)
slot slot-number: Specifies an IRF member device by its member ID. If you do not specify a member
device, this command displays information for the master device. (Centralized devices in IRF mode.)
chassis chassis-number slot slot-number: Specifies a card on an IRF member device. The
chassis-number argument represents the member ID of the IRF member device. The slot-number
argument represents the slot number of the card. If you do not specify a card, this command displays
information for the global active MPU. (Distributed devices in IRF mode.)
cpu cpu-number: Specifies a CPU by its number. (Centralized devices in IRF mode/distributed
devices in IRF or standalone mode.)
Usage guidelines
Heap memory comprises fixed-sized blocks such as 16-byte or 64-byte blocks. It stores data and
variables used by the user process. When a user process starts, the system dynamically allocates
heap memory to the process.
Each memory block has an address represented in hexadecimal format, which can be used to
access the memory block. You can view memory block addresses by using the display process
memory heap size command, and view memory block contents by using the display process
memory heap address command.
Examples
# Display brief information about heap memory usage for the process identified by job ID 148.
<Sysname> display process memory heap job 148
Total virtual memory heap space(in bytes) : 2228224
Total physical memory heap space(in bytes) : 262144
